What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.1053(a)(7): Ladders were tied or fastened together to provide longer sections that were not specifically designed for such use:    (a)CRG Painting at 8008 Montview Blvd., Denver, CO 80220:  The employer tied a 40 foot and a 10 foot aluminum step ladder together to provide a longer ladder to reach the upper areas of the exterior portions of an apartment building.  This condition exposed the employees to a fall hazard of approximately 45 feet.

29 CFR 1926.1060(a): The employer did not provide a training program for each employee using ladders and stairways, as necessary. The program shall enable each employee to recognize hazards related to ladders and stairways, and shall train each employee in the procedures to be followed to minimize these hazards:    (a)CRG Painting at 8008 Montview Blvd., Denver, CO 80220:  The employer did not conduct training to enable the employees to recognize hazards related to ladders.  This condition exposed to the employees to hazards associated with ladder use to include but not limited to fall hazards.
